
Bayern Munich have secured their 15th consecutive win of the season in all competitions today, beating Bayer Leverkusen 3-0 at the Allianz Arena.
Vincent Kompany started the match by leaving several important starters on the bench, knowing that next midweek they will face a super challenge with PSG in the Champions League. This match will be a big test for Bayern, as they will face a truly dignified rival.
Regarding today's match. In the 25th minute, it was Serzh Gnabry who opened the scoring, sending the ball into the net, after an assist from Bischof.
Nicholas Jackson doubled the lead in the 31st minute, heading home a cross from Konrad Laimer. It was the Senegalese forward's first Bundesliga goal. At the end of the first half, Loic Balde scored an own goal for the visitors. The French defender headed in a cross from Joshua Kimmich.
In the second half, even though big names like Kane, Oliseh and Luis Diaz came on, the score remained the same. Bayern won 3-0 and are leading with 27 points after 9 games. The closest follower is Leipzig with 22 points.
